Hey @oschif, thanks for getting back to us. I apologize I misunderstood your initial question.

It's not actually possible to filter for exact word matches. If you could tell me a little more about your use case, I'll be happy to pass that information along to our Product team as a feature request.

I have exactly the same problem as @oschif . When I search for the website: nu.nl, the result is a list, containing all nu's, nl's and other rubbish. In other softwareprograms, I can ask then: search "nu.nl", between quotationmarks. Then the results are exactly what I want.

November 17, 2023

And, in addition to the above remark, in the Windows desktop program, the search between quotation marks does not work. But, surprisingly, in the Android app on my phone, searching between quotationmarks gives the exact results.
